More Vandalism

Here are two examples of vandalism that lead to soil erosion and increases sediment in Spring River. The first is the result of a 4WD pickup truck, driving off of Highway U down the embankment. You can see the effect of disrupting the natural cover on the highly erodible embankment. Multiple milkweeds were run over, just as their buds were ready to bloom. This is food for the Monarch butterflies that will no longer be available.

This vandalism was done over the weekend, motorcycles off the road, under the bridge, disrupting the soil, making it susceptable to erosion and polution in the river. The tire tread patterns (both the truck and motorcycle) have been recorded for Law Enforcment.
